CHARGE OF INTOXICATION
MASTERTON MOTORIST BEFORE COURT. REMANDED UNTIT. NEXT WEEK. A charge of being intoxicated while in charge of a motor-car was preferred against Joseph James Lwington in the Masterton Magistrate’s Court this morning. „ , Messrs A. D. Low and E. M. Hodder, J.’sP.. were on the Bench. On the application of Senior-Ser-geant G. A. Doggett, accused was remanded until February 23. Bail was allowed self £25 and one surety of £25. Ewington was arrested in Chapel Street last night.
